"To love is to take delight in happiness of another, or, what amounts to the same thing, it is to account another's happiness as one's own."

— Gottfried Leibniz

Business is about problem-solving, but it does not always have to be about maximizing profit. When I went into business, my interest was to figure out how to solve problems I see in front of me. That's why I looked at the poverty issue. I got involved in lots of things to address it, and one of them was money lending with loans and credits and savings accounts, and in the process I created Grameen Bank. So you can also have social objectives. Ask yourself these questions: Who are you? What kind of world do you want?

— Muhammad Yunus
